True Love Brewster Cocktail
Plymouth Gin

This fresh beer cocktail, created by Summer Bell of Oakland's The New Easy, marries aromatic Plymouth gin, lemon juice, golden raisin purée, and rosemary-infused honey, and is topped with a splash of bitter IPA.

INGREDIENTS

  • 1 1/2 ounces Plymouth Gin
  • 1/5 ounce fresh lemon juice
  • 1/2 ounce golden raisin purée
  • 1/2 ounce rosemary-infused honey
  • Ice
  • 1 ounce IPA beer
  • raisins, cut in half, for garnish

DIRECTIONS

For the golden raisin purée: Simmer 4 cups of golden raisins with 6 cups of water and 1/2 cup of honey for 20 minutes then blend in a Vitamix till very smooth. Fine-strain through a chinois and let cool.
For the rosemary-infused honey: Make a honey simple syrup by simmering with a ratio 1:1 honey to water. Take off the heat and while still hot add several bunches of fresh rosemary. Let steep for 1 hour or to taste.
For the cocktail: Combine all of the liquid ingredients (except for the IPA) in a shaker with ice. Shake, then strain over fresh ice and top with beer. Garnish with some of the raisin halves.
